What does "border" mean?

  1. noun The line separating two countries, states, or regions.
    "They crossed the border into Canada just before sunset."
  2. noun The outer edge of something, or a decorative strip around that edge.
    "The tablecloth had a lace border sewn around the edges."
  3. verb To share a boundary with, or lie right next to.
    "France borders Spain to the south."
